| City | Arenas Valley |
| State | New Mexico (NM) |
| County | Grant County |
| Country | United States of America |
| Timezone | Mountain Time (America/Denver) |
| Latitude | 32.775647 |
| Longitude | -108.203136 |
| Population | 1,291 |
| Density | 122.6 /km² |
| Incorporated | N/A |
| ZIP Code | 88022 |
| Area Code | 575 |
| County Seat | Silver City |
| School District | Silver City Consolidated Schools |
Arenas Valley stretches across a high, sun-drenched plateau where the arid earth meets the expansive, shifting shadows cast by the rugged silhouette of Snake Hill. It lies 44.0 miles northwest of Deming, NM (from Deming, NM: bearing 326°T), and is situated 5.8 miles east-northeast of Silver City. Whiskey Creek cuts a winding, seasonal path through the dry terrain, providing a vital artery for the scrub brush and resilient grasses that cling to the alkaline soil.
